Hence, 10 n will be a 1 followed by n zeros Thus, 10 4 = 10, 000, 10 5 = 100, 000, etc The exponent tells us how many zeros will follow the 1 Let's divide 123456.7 by 1000

123456.7 divided by 1000 is 123.4567 Dividing by 1000 moves the decimal point 3 places to the left This discussion leads to the following result.
